About Blacklake, CA

Blacklake is a small community in California with a population of 1,122 residents. The median household income is $99,191 per year, which is above the national average. The median age in Blacklake is 69.3 years.

Housing in Blacklake has a median home value of $821,600 and median monthly rent of $3,203. Of the 677 total housing units, the majority are owner-occupied, with 468 owner-occupied and 94 renter-occupied units.

The unemployment rate in Blacklake is 0.0% and the poverty rate is 0.7%. 56.0% of residents h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The average commute time is 17.8 minutes.

Cost of Living in Blacklake, CA

Compared to national averages, Blacklake has a median household income of $99,191 (32% above the national median of $75,149). Home values average $821,600, which is 235% above the national median. Monthly rent at $3,203 is 175% above the US average of $1,163. Within California, Blacklake's income is 1% above the state average of $97,829, and home values are 26% above the state median of $653,874.
